摘要
Matrix-assisted laser desorption ionization time-of-flight mass spectrometry (MALDI-TOF MS or simply MALDI)(1) has become ubiquitous in the identification and analysis of biomacromolecules. As a technique that allows for the molecular weight determination of otherwise nonvolatile molecules, MALDI has had a profound impact in the molecular biosciences, especially in the field of proteomics. MALDI analysis of whole organisms allows for the generation of a phenotypic profile or "molecular fingerprint;" once established, these fingerprints can be used for identification purposes.
